Embracing Freedom: Buddy C’s Step 8 Meditation
There is real freedom in acknowledging the harm that we've done to others. What we find is that the real harm was to ourselves, and I can heal that harm by mending the harm that I did to others.
Picture this: you're on the path to recovery, and the weight of past mistakes feels like a heavy burden. In this episode of 'Sober Meditations', Buddy C. introduces a quick, 5-minute meditation focused on Step 8, which is all about finding freedom through taking responsibility. Buddy, who has been sober since 2008 after battling relentless relapses, shares his journey and how embracing the powerlessness over alcohol changed his life.
He discusses the transformative impact of acknowledging the harm done to others and making amends as a way to heal yourself. Through this brief yet powerful meditation, Buddy offers practical tips to help you slow down, tune into your higher power, and start letting go of guilt and shame.
